Output d604acac0ba6c3e4b97dd7bb5e72c82994e7cd752217eff6cd0ec05a0c775e5e:15

value
7623705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f62ec996b635e30534a53a5250469bc4316bd1b OP_EQUAL
address
3BqySDFGqfbmx52PhZA8BDN4am7A6QPR2N
transaction
d604acac0ba6c3e4b97dd7bb5e72c82994e7cd752217eff6cd0ec05a0c775e5e
spent
true